Abstract :
Several factors greatly influence the quality of service (QoS) in multihop wireless mesh networks (WMNs). These include the transmission range, number of gateways, number of nodes served by each gateway, gateway location, relay load and access fairness. While finding an optimal solution to simultaneously satisfy the above constraints is known to be MV-hard, near optimal solutions can be found within the feasibility region in polynomial time using heuristic algorithms. In this paper, first we present a near optimal heuristics algorithm for gateway placement, and later we compare its performance with some previously known sub-optimal solutions.
